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Cleanup
Water damage can be sneaky, but there are often warning signs that show a problem.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Here are some common warning signs that you need Water Damage Cleanup in Oologah, OK: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show water damage, especially if they’re accompanied by visible signs of moisture or mold growth. Don’t ignore these odors, as they can be a sign of a larger problem.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can appear as brown or yellow spots on ceilings or walls. If you notice these stains,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the cause and pr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to warp or buckle, especially if it’s made of wood or laminate.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s.
Mold Growth
Mold growth can appear as black or green spots on walls, ceilings, or floors. If you notice mold growth, it’s essential to address the issue immediately to prevent health hazards.
Water Leaks Under Sinks or Around Appliances
Water leaks can be a sign of a larger problem, especially if they’re accompanied by water damage or mold growth. Don’t ignore these leaks, as they can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ards.
Water Damage Cleanup v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or water leak under a sink | Yes | No | You can fix the leak yourself and prevent further damage. |
| Catastrophic flood in your basement | No | Yes | This is a serious situation that needs professional expertise and equipment to mitigate the damage.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e | No | Yes | This is a complex situation that needs professional assessment and repair to prevent further damage. |
| Water stains on ceilings or walls | No | Yes | This is a sign of a larger problem that needs professional investigation and repair. |
| Mold growth in your home | No | Yes | This is a serious health hazard that needs professional remediation and repair. |
| Water damage from a storm | No | Yes | This is a complex situation that needs professional expertise and equipment to mitigate the damage. |

Water Damage Cleanup Cost in Oologah, OK
The cost of Water Damage Cleanup in Oologah, OK can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ions. Our team will provide you with a free estimate and work with your insurance company to ensure that the repairs are covered. Here are some estimated price ranges for common Water Damage Cleanup services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ning needed, and equipment used. |
| Repair and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and materials used. |
| Antimicrobial treatment |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and type of treatment needed. |
| Dehumidification and air movement |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and equipment needed. |
| Disinfection and odor removal |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and equipment used. |
